The hexadecimal color code #57DBAF corresponds to the code RGB( 87, 219, 175 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,34 level), green (at 0,86 level) and blue (at 0,69 level). Its brightness is 60% and its saturation is 64%. It is composed of red at 18%, green at 45% and blue at 36%.

Uses of #57DBAF in CSS

When using #57DBAF as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#57DBAF as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
